TRACEWEAVE RUNBOOK — new hires. Every request entering the Lintbarrow mesh gets a trace ID at the edge; services must propagate it in the context header, never regenerate it. If spans look orphaned, check the collector sidecar first — it buffers for 30 seconds before flushing. Querying the internal span store requires an authenticated token on each call. The shared read-only key for the dev environment follows below.

API key for yahig-tadup: kto7_ubizbYm

**09:12** — Parcelbeam webhook stopped delivering scan events to Cartonly. **09:20** — Found retry queue stuck after a malformed signature header. **09:34** — Purged bad message, deliveries resumed. **09:50** — Backfill complete. New contractor note: always check the queue depth dashboard first. The patched deploy is identified by the token below.

trace token, fafog-kageg: htk4_98e6

**Ticket: Order cutoff ignored for next-day pickup — Crumbline POS.** Several bakeries on the Hollowfield pilot report that orders placed after the 4 p.m. cutoff are still being accepted for next-day pickup, overloading early shifts. The cutoff rule evaluates against server UTC instead of the store's local timezone, so shops west of the reference zone get an extra window. Workaround: manually reject late orders from the queue view. Fix is staged; the trace token for the patched build is listed below.

build token for tawip-yageg: htk9_92ac43d42

The Wayfinder autocomplete widget debounces keystrokes before querying the suggestion service, then ranks candidates by prefix match and regional bias. New team members should note that latency budgets are tight: anything over 120ms feels laggy in usability tests run by the Brindlemoor group. The debounce, cache, and ranking behavior are governed by the constants below:

tuning table, faweg-bajep:
WEIGHTS = {
    "belius": 690,
    "eliox": 458,
    "norax": 616,
    "praion": 132,
    "zorvan": 911,
}